On Sun, Jul 19, 2020 at 02:44:08PM +0900, Daeho Jeong wrote: > From: Daeho Jeong <daehojeong@google.com> > > Added a symbolic link directory pointing to its device name > directory using the volume name of the partition in sysfs. > (i.e., /sys/fs/f2fs/vol_#x -> /sys/fs/f2fs/sda1)
No, please no.
That is already created today for you in /dev/disk/ The kernel does not need to do this again.
If your distro/system/whatever does not provide you with /dev/disk/ and all of the symlinks in there, then work with your distro/system/whatever to do so.
Again, no need to do this on a per-filesystem-basis when we already have this around for all filesystems, and have had it for 15+ years now.
